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6877 622 39875051
2786326 84874 08325571860
2786326 84874 08325571860
738174004 323804 00607493
All about undefined
Interested in learning more?
2786326 84874 08325571860
738174004 323804 00607493
See more
236 32132213
991 61482 82072628
See more
42220018 79934 8270716
5647626 036183 76223239010 59634741187
See more